How to Spot a Rogue “Best Casino Not on Gamblock 2026 UK Instant Play”

I have a checklist. I use it every time. It has saved me from losing money at least three times this year.

  1. Check the License Number: Scroll to the footer. If it says “Curacao eGaming,” look for the specific license number. Then google it. If it is not listed on the Curacao official registry, it is fake.
  2. Test the Withdrawal Page: Go to the banking section before you register. Look for “Pending Time.” If it says “Up to 72 hours,” that is normal. If it says “Up to 7 business days,” that is a red flag. They are holding your money.
  3. Read the Bonus T&C Like a Lawyer: Specifically look for “Max Bet” rules. Some casinos say “Max bet £5 while bonus is active.” If you accidentally bet £6, they void your winnings. I have seen this happen.
  4. Look for UK-Specific Payment Methods: If a site only accepts Bitcoin and no PayPal, Trustly, or debit cards, it is probably targeting players who cannot use UKGC sites. That does not make it a scam, but it makes it riskier.

Instant Play vs. Download: Why I Only Use Instant Play for Non-Gamblock Sites

I never download software from a casino that is not on Gamblock. It is too risky. A download client could contain spyware or keyloggers. Instant play (browser-based) is safer because it runs in a sandboxed environment.

For the best casino not on gamblock 2026 uk instant play experience, you want HTML5 games that load directly in Chrome or Safari. No plugins. No downloads. Every major provider (NetEnt, Microgaming, Play’n GO) supports this now. If a site forces you to download a client to play, that is a massive red flag in 2026.
